About This Role

About UsBanner Ridge Partners is a $15 billion AUM private equity firm investing across primary, secondary and co-investment transactions with a focus on distressed, special situations, opportunistic credit and deep-value investments. Headquartered in New York City, the team has a fourteen-year track record delivering 25%+ net returns to investors. Banner Ridge’s 25+ person team is primarily comprised of investment professionals. Job DescriptionBanner Ridge is seeking a high-performing and self-motivated Investment Analyst to join its underwriting investment team. The ideal candidate is detail-oriented and entrepreneurial, with strong investment acumen and a passion for working within an opportunistic investment mandate at a growing, collaborative firm. The primary responsibilities include:Conducting in-depth research and analysis on potential investments across different transaction types, industries and securities throughout the capital structureWorking in small deal teams to complete thorough due diligence efforts, including frequent interaction with private equity fund managers, company management teams and industry expertsBuilding, maintaining and updating advanced financial models in Excel for valuation and return analysis of portfolios and single assets, including secondaries, credit and leveraged buyout modelsPreparing extensive investment memoranda, presentations and other materials summarizing the investment analysis outputs and providing investment recommendations and discussing the investment thesis in front of the investment committeeParticipating in deal structuring, valuation and execution processesAssisting with portfolio management and ongoing monitoring of fund interests and underlying portfolio companies through continuous review of reports, financial statements and public disclosuresMaintaining and updating the firm’s deal pipeline database to ensure accuracy and completeness of all relevant dataActively contributing to the team’s collaborative culture by generating and sharing actionable investment ideas across strategies Key Attributes & Requirements0.5-2 years of relevant experience in a finance-related role, including investment banking, private equity, private credit, consulting and/or secondariesBachelor’s degree from a leading university with a strong academic record; majors in economics, finance or mathematics preferredDemonstrated financial modeling expertise commensurate with sophisticated investment analysisStrong intellectual and analytical capabilities with a demonstrated ability to structure and solve complex problems and exceptional attention to detailExcellent interpersonal, communication and presentation skills with the ability to build strong professional relationshipsSuperior organizational and time management skills, a strong work ethic and the ability to perform effectively under pressureAvailable for full-time, on-site employment at the firm’s Midtown Manhattan office (five days per week)
